About the Role

The Company is in search of a Vice President of Sustainability to lead and drive its sustainability efforts. The successful candidate will be tasked with creating and implementing a comprehensive sustainability strategy that is in line with the company's vision and principles. This includes developing a framework for initiatives, setting goals and targets, and establishing key performance indicators. The role also involves leading a team of sustainability professionals, managing projects, and ensuring that the company is in compliance with standards and regulations. The ideal candidate should have a minimum of 15 years' experience in sustainability or a related field, with a proven track record of success, and possess strong leadership, communication, and project management skills. Applicants for the Vice President of Sustainability position at the company should be prepared to work in a fast-paced, high-growth environment and be adept at building and maintaining relationships with both internal and external stakeholders. The role requires a Bachelor's degree in a related field, with a Master's degree preferred, and a deep knowledge of current sustainability trends and best practices. The candidate must be able to anticipate and respond to future challenges and opportunities in the sustainability landscape. Responsibilities also include monitoring and reporting on progress, as well as ensuring that the company is well-positioned to meet future policy and regulatory impacts. The company is an equal-opportunity employer and is committed to creating a diverse and inclusive work environment.
